What is Product ID?

Product ID is a methodology which helps in identifying a product without a full specifications specified on the label. In case of shipping and transportation of the items each and every document associated with the product carries this unique Product ID. It helps in tracking the item in any part of the supply chain.


It can also be referred as SKU, Item Code or Number. It is generally an alphanumeric code. This code is entered into the system like Material Resource Planning or related software packages. When the particular code is entered into the system the details of the product is displayed by the system.


Benefits

1. Proper Identification and tracking of the product or consignment in a Supply Chain.

2. Helps in facilitating in reverse logistics or pickup of the product
